Spring Symphony/ Welcome Ode/ Psalm 150

Spring Symphony/ Welcome Ode/ Psalm 150

composed by Benjamin Britten, 1913-1976; conducted by Richard Hickox, 1948-; produced by Brian Couzens, 1933-2015; performed by Alfreda Hodgson, Elizabeth Gale, 1948- and Martyn Hill, City of London School Choir, London Symphony Chorus, Southend Boys' Choir and London Symphony Orchestra (LSO) (Chandos, 1990), 59 mins
